Nuclear and ionising radiation detection and dosimetry

Nuclear and ionising radiation detection and dosimetry

Our services include the use of techniques to develop innovative radiation detector technology, such as performing alpha spectroscopy to characterise charge collection capability and radiation transport simulation.  We also have expertise in measuring the electrical characteristics of novel detectors and semiconductor devices.

Shorebirds & Wetlands Incursion outline and syllabus

Shorebirds & Wetlands Incursion outline and syllabus

Students are introduced to shorebirds and their wetland habitats. They encounter the incredible journeys of our migratory shorebirds and how they connect wetlands in a fun playground game. Students also participate in a hands-on adaptations activity and learn about environmental research conducted at ANSTO.
